10 Employer Branding Success Factors to Embrace - dummies ~ Getting your leadership teamā€™s buy-in for your employer branding strategy. Effective employer branding starts at the top. The executive team needs to be onboard to communicate in words and actions that delivering a positive employment experience and building a strong employer brand reputation are critically important to the success of the business.

Employer Branding Doā€™s and Donā€™ts / Talentera ~ Once work on employer branding is in motion, you need to keep track of its performance and measure its impact on your workforce and the talent pool obtained. This can be done by monitoring review sites, job boards, search engines and social media. You should also actively compare usersā€™ interest in your employer brand to that of your competitors.

5 Signs You're Ruining Your Employer Brand ~ The result was that many current female employees of GoDaddy, and some potential female candidates, were offended by the ads and didnā€™t want to work for a company that seemed so degrading. Fast forward a few years, and GoDaddy has worked very hard to regain the trust of those female job seekers by realizing the impact of what they had done and working together with women to repair the damage.
